Output 53fdac760c7d97529f28c9aca652163c24b3e54645cf4f35504f510b2e058468:0

value
81580341
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18ba1fe7d6625431f234d1d0e34822e7202c647c OP_EQUALVERIFY OP_CHECKSIG
address
LMUhSyyD5KN4amoeedEYeyNKrfCN8NNaPG
transaction
53fdac760c7d97529f28c9aca652163c24b3e54645cf4f35504f510b2e058468
spent
true